  • Thompson speaks on hypocrisy from Matthew 23:13-19. He gives a definition and examples of hypocrisy. Thompson details the hypocrisy of the Pharisees and the scribes, exploring appearing to spread the gospel, but actually building up ourselves. He shows that what comes out of the heart is more important than outward appearance. Talk delivered just after the start of the Ukrainian war.
